Portugal, officially the Portuguese Republic is a country situated in southwestern Europe on the Iberian Peninsula. Portugal is the westernmost country of Europe, and is bordered by the Atlantic Ocean to the West and South and by Spain to the North and East. The Atlantic archipelagos of the Azores and Madeira are part of Portugal. The country is named after its second largest city, Porto, whose Latin name was Portus Cale. Portuguese is the official language of Portugal. Portuguese is a Romance language that originated in what is now Galicia (Spain) and Northern Portugal, from the Galician-Portuguese language. Portugal's largest cities are all majestically-sited by grand rivers and are a delightful mix of the historical and the contemporary -- Lisbon is one of Europe's most alluring capitals, while it is hard to beat charismatic Porto's singular atmosphere and magnificent setting. Coimbra, dominated by one of the world's oldest universities also demands attention, but even more memorable is exploring the country's timeless medieval towns.
